lib/rubocop/cop/chef/deprecation/node_deep_fetch.rb in cookstyle-6.19.5 vs lib/rubocop/cop/chef/deprecation/node_deep_fetch.rb in cookstyle-6.19.11
- old
+ new
@@ -35,9 +35,11 @@
# node.read!("foo")
#
class NodeDeepFetch < Base
extend RuboCop::Cop::AutoCorrector
+ RESTRICT_ON_SEND = [:deep_fetch, :deep_fetch!].freeze
+
def_node_matcher :node_deep_fetch?, <<-PATTERN
(send (send _ :node) ${:deep_fetch :deep_fetch!} _)
PATTERN
def on_send(node)